A Blessing If You Would Learn

The heart when young, so blissful and knows no sin
the mind's ego knows no bounds, its strength within

The earth, sound and steep, its fruits the soul entice
the taste of spice great! to every slice a price

The eyes rain and the mouth would savour its pain
when dry is your land, sow no seed, reap no grain

Valiant steps fear no edge nor the burn of sands
wish die for the glory of walking God's Lands

Specks of dust make souls blind can turn lives to dust
just a spark of deep Faith heralds paths to trust

Ascend and observe, gems in you aim to earn
What seems as harm, a blessing if you would learn

God for you paves paths and lends many a hand
a deep well of Love granted to flood your land

Those warm drops of Love and Life, in time of birth
brought heaven under your feet, mothers of earth

Peace and joy in voice of heart to God raise praise
light in soul,  a power with beauty would blaze

Brushes and pens paint and a language translate
the soul ebb and flow beyond language and state.
